Exporter (0) Imprimer
Développer tout

Types de données (Base de données SQL Azure)

Mis à jour: décembre 2013

Cette rubrique est obsolète. La version actualisée est disponible à la page Référence SQL 14 Transact-SQL.

Microsoft Base de données SQL Microsoft Azure fournit la prise en charge d'une grande partie des types de données système SQL Server. Cette rubrique décrit les types de données système pris en charge et non pris en charge.

Le tableau suivant répertorie les catégories de type de données et décrit la prise en charge des types de données système :

 

Catégorie de type de données Prise en charge de Base de données SQL

Valeurs numériques exactes

Pris en charge : bigint, bit, decimal, int, money, numeric, smallint, smallmoney, tinyint.

Valeurs numériques approximatives

Pris en charge : float, real.

Date et heure

Pris en charge : date, datetime2, datetime, datetimeoffset, smalldatetime, time.

Chaînes de caractères

Pris en charge : char, varchar, text.

Chaînes de caractères Unicode

Pris en charge : nchar, nvarchar, ntext.

Chaînes binaires

Pris en charge : binary, varbinary, image.

Types de données spatiales

Pris en charge : geography, geometry.

Autres types de données

Pris en charge : cursor, hierarchyid, sql_variant, table, timestamp, uniqueidentifier, xml.

ImportantImportant
Base de données SQL Microsoft Azure ne prend pas en charge les types de données du Common Language Runtime (CLR) définis par l'utilisateur. Pour plus d'informations sur les types de données spécifiés dans cette rubrique, consultez Types de données (Transact-SQL) dans la Documentation en ligne de SQL Server.

Prise en charge des méthodes de type de données geography

Base de données SQL Microsoft Azure prend en charge les méthodes OGC suivantes sur le type de données geography :

 

STArea

STEndPoint

STNumPoints

STAsBinary

STEquals

STOverlaps

STAsText

STGeometryN

STPointN

STBuffer

STGeometryType

STSrid

STContains

STIntersection

STStartPoint

STConvexHull

STIntersects

STSymDifference

STDifference

STIsClosed

STUnion

STDimension

STIsEmpty

STWithin

STDisjoint

STLength

 

STDistance

STNumGeometries

Base de données SQL Microsoft Azure prend en charge les méthodes OGC statiques suivantes sur le type de données geography :

 

STGeomFromText

STMPolyFromText

STPolyFromWKB

STPointFromText

STGeomCollFromText

STMPointFromWKB

STLineFromText

STGeomCollFromWKB

STMLineFromWKB

STPolyFromText

STGeomFromWKB

STMPolyFromWKB

STMPointFromText

STPointFromWKB

STMLineFromText

STLineFromWKB

Base de données SQL Microsoft Azure prend en charge les méthodes étendues suivantes sur le type de données geography :

 

AsGml

IsNull

ReorientObject

AsTextZM

M

ShortestLineTo

BufferWithTolerance

MakeValid

ToString

Filter

MinDbCompatibilityLevel

Z

InstanceOf

Reduce

 

Base de données SQL Microsoft Azure prend en charge les méthodes statiques étendues suivantes sur le type de données geography :

 

GeomFromGml

Parse

Point

Null

   

Prise en charge des méthodes de type de données geometry

Base de données SQL Microsoft Azure prend en charge les méthodes OGC suivantes sur le type de données geometry :

 

STArea

STEquals

STNumPoints

STAsBinary

STExteriorRing

STOverlaps

STAsText

STGeometryN

STPointN

STBoundary

STGeometryType

STPointOnSurface

STBuffer

STInteriorRingN

STRelate

STCentroid

STIntersection

STSrid

STContains

STIntersects

STStartPoint

STConvexHull

STIsClosed

STSymDifference

STCrosses

STIsEmpty

STTouches

STDifference

STIsRing

STUnion

STDimension

STIsSimple

STWithin

STDisjoint

STIsValid

STX

STDistance

STLength

STY

STEndPoint

STNumGeometries

 

STEnvelope

STNumInteriorRing

Base de données SQL Microsoft Azure prend en charge les méthodes OGC statiques suivantes sur le type de données geometry :

 

STSGeomFromText

STMPolyFromText

STPolyFromWKB

STPointFromText

STGeomCollFromText

STMPointFromWKB

STLineFromText

STGeomCollFromWKB

STMLineFromWKB

STPolyFromText

STGeomFromWKB

STPolyFromWKB

STMPointFromText

STPointFromWKB

STMLineFromText

STLineFromWKB

Base de données SQL Microsoft Azure prend en charge les méthodes étendues suivantes sur le type de données geometry :

 

AsGml

IsNull

ShortestLineTo

AsTextZM

M

ToString

BufferWithTolerance

MakeValid

Z

Filter

MinDbCompatibilitylevel

 

InstanceOf

Reduce

 

Base de données SQL Microsoft Azure prend en charge les méthodes statiques étendues suivantes sur le type de données geometry :

 

GeomFromGml

Parse

Point

Null

   

Prise en charge des méthodes de type de données hierarchyid

Base de données SQL Microsoft Azure prend en charge les méthodes suivantes sur le type de données hierarchyid :

 

GetAncestor

IsDescendantOf

ToString

GetDescendant

Parse

Write

GetLevel

Lire

GetRoot

GetReparentedValue

Type de données xml

Base de données SQL Microsoft Azure prend en charge le type de données xml qui stocke des données XML. Vous pouvez stocker des instances xml dans une colonne ou dans une variable du type xml

Prise en charge du langage XML DML

Le langage de modification de données XML (XML DML) est une extension du langage XQuery. Il ajoute les mots clés sensibles à la casse suivants à XQuery, qui sont pris en charge dans Base de données SQL Microsoft Azure :

  • insert (XML DML)

  • delete (DML XML)

  • replace value of (XML DML)

Prise en charge des méthodes du type de données xml

Vous pouvez utiliser les méthodes de type de données xml pour interroger une instance XML stockée dans une variable ou une colonne du type xml. Base de données SQL Microsoft Azure prend en charge les méthodes de type de données xml suivantes :

  • méthode query() (type de données xml) ;

  • méthode value() (type de données xml) ;

  • méthode exist() (type de données xml)

  • méthode modify() (type de données xml)

  • méthode nodes() (type de données xml)

Voir aussi

Ajouts de la communauté

AJOUTER
Afficher:
© 2014 Microsoft